Yeah well, lets focus on this look. I found this dress around summer 2017 on a First Saturday when everything at Nashville's Goodwill stores are 50% off. I could not resist. It was two sizes too big but for $3 why not?! I knew that I would want to shoot in around the holidays because I loved the metallic colors print on it, but honestly this dress could be worn anytime. I paired with another pieces that I have eagerly waited for a couple of years to wear which is the this amazing vintage fur that I paid $40. I almost passed it up but on a rare occasion of hubs and I at Goodwill, he insisted that I take it home.

I took the dress to my seamstress and got it altered, literally picked it up just in time for my shoot that morning.
